The Verdict: Which is Better?
When placing Lightly Salted Pistachios and Sliced Pepper Jack side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.
Lightly Salted Pistachios is the more energy-dense option here, packing 180 more calories per 100g than Sliced Pepper Jack.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.
However, watch out for the sugar content. Lightly Salted Pistachios contains significantly more sugar (7.14g) compared to the milder Sliced Pepper Jack (0g). If you are monitoring your insulin levels or trying to cut down on sweets, Sliced Pepper Jack is undeniably the healthier pick.
